What is a caseworker assistant?

A caseworker assistant supports caseworkers by helping manage client records, schedule appointments, and prepare documentation. They often work in social services, healthcare, or legal settings and may require strong organizational skills and familiarity with case management software.

What are Case Worker Assistants?

Case Worker Assistants are professionals who support case workers in providing social services to individuals and families in need. They help with administrative tasks, documentation, and follow-up communications, ensuring that case workers can focus on client assessments and interventions. Case Worker Assistants may also interact directly with clients to gather information, schedule appointments, and offer basic guidance or resources under supervision. Their role is essential for maintaining efficient case management and delivering quality care to clients.

How does a Case Worker Assistant typically collaborate with case workers and other team members on client cases?

Case Worker Assistants play a crucial supportive role by gathering client information, maintaining case files, and helping coordinate services. They regularly communicate with case workers to provide updates, ensure documentation is up-to-date, and assist with scheduling appointments or follow-ups. Collaboration often extends to working with external agencies or community organizations, making teamwork and clear communication essential. This collaborative structure allows Case Worker Assistants to learn from experienced professionals, develop their skills, and contribute significantly to positive client outcomes.

What is the difference between Case Worker Assistant vs Social Worker?

AspectCase Worker AssistantSocial Worker
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certification or associate degreeBachelor's degree in social work or related field; licensure often required
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, community agencies, healthcare facilitiesSame as Case Worker Assistant, often with more independent case management
Employer & Industry UsageNonprofit organizations, government agencies, healthcare providersSame as Case Worker Assistant, with broader responsibilities
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level roles, responsibilities, and qualificationsSeeking advanced roles, responsibilities, and licensing requirements

While both roles work in similar environments and share some qualifications, a Case Worker Assistant typically supports social workers with case management tasks and requires less formal education. Social Workers have more responsibilities, often require a degree and licensure, and handle complex cases independently.

Job description

Theย Immigrant & Refugee Services Divisionย at Catholic Charities of the Archdiocese of Newark seeks aย Case Worker/Case Worker Assistantย to provide case management services to Refugee Program clients. The Case Worker will be responsible for the following primary job duties: The Case Worker Assistant will support the Case Worker(s) in the following duties:

  • 1) Conducting intake and service planning for refugee clients, including asylees, refugees, parolees, Cuban-Haitian entrants, and Special Immigrant Visa holders
  • 2) Providing individualized assistance to clients through identification of clientsโ€™ needs
  • 3) Writing a plan of action to assist the client in obtaining and pursuing services that meet their needs
  • 4) Preparing case write-ups and referrals to a range of social, medical, and legal services
  • 6 Coordinating referrals to the County Board of Social Services (food stamps and Medicaid), employment, housing, and English language training
  • 7) Conducting monthly check-in sessions and case follow-up meeting with clients
  • 8) Performing any other duties and responsibilities requested by the supervisor

Required qualifications:

  • 1) Case Worker - Bachelor's degree, Case Worker Assistant - High school diploma or equivalent
  • 2) Bilingual English/Spanish OR English/Haitian Creole
  • 3) Ability to handle several projects and tasks simultaneously
  • 4) Willingness to collaborate with team members on program and division issues and projects
  • 5) Commitment to working in a non-profit setting
  • 6) Ability and willingness to establish and maintain a harmonious working relationship with clients, staff, professional & business community contacts and the public
